Ye Qiu watched the woman before him, a woman even his master, the old lecher, valued, standing right in front of him.
Mu Zhige was very respectful, saying aloud, "Leader, this is Ye Qiu."
The middle-aged woman didn’t speak, examining Ye Qiu, who did not avoid her gaze, letting her take him in while he also scrutinized her.
Based on the old lecher’s tone, this woman should be about the same age as him, but just by looks, he really couldn’t associate this woman with his unkempt master.
The old lecher was always disheveled, never caring for his appearance, looking like a man in his sixties or seventies, while the woman before him—aside from two wrinkles at the corners of her eyes—showed no sign of her age on her face.
Ye Qiu guessed at the relationship between the old lecher and the woman before him. If judging by appearance alone, she was even more beautiful than Master Jingxin, both in figure and facial features.
Ye Qiu couldn’t figure out why the old lecher didn’t pursue this woman and instead set his sights on Master Jingxin.
He just couldn’t understand the old lecher’s taste!
The quizzical expression on Ye Qiu’s face didn’t escape the middle-aged woman’s notice; she slightly frowned and said indifferently, "I heard you are quite skilled."
"You flatter me. Compared to you, I still have a long way to go," replied Ye Qiu with modesty.
"Heh, you bear a striking resemblance to your master in demeanor, but I wonder if you have learned even a fraction of his skills," the middle-aged woman said.
"Master sent me to join the Dragon Group so I could learn from you," Ye Qiu said with a smile.
Mu Zhige stood by, pondering who Ye Qiu’s master might be. No wonder Ye Qiu was classified as an S-Level confidential person and his integration into the Dragon Group seemed exceptionally smooth. It appeared his ties with the leader were probably not shallow.
Mu Zhige, alone with his wild guesses, listened as the middle-aged woman said, "I never thought that old guy would admit he’s not my equal. If he wants me to teach his disciple, fine, but first, let’s see if you are worth my time to teach."
"May I ask, senior, how should I prove myself?" Ye Qiu responded with a question.
The middle-aged woman gave a mysterious smile and replied, "Don’t worry; when the time comes, you will naturally understand."
Ye Qiu had no idea what kind of game the middle-aged woman was playing, but he remained silent, only listening as she instructed, "Zhige, later take him to the room we’ve prepared for her, and also show him around, introduce him to this place."
Mu Zhige nodded, and as the two left the office, they saw many people gathered outside, staring at this place. When they spotted the unfamiliar face of Ye Qiu beside Mu Zhige, they cast hostile gazes.
Ye Qiu was well aware of the hostility from these people. Frowning, he didn’t understand why they showed him such expressions—had he done something to earn the wrath of heaven and the hatred of people?
The culprit, Mu Zhige, scratched his head awkwardly and quickly pulled Ye Qiu out of everyone’s sight, taking him to a room made entirely of metal.
"Uhm... Brother Ye, as you know, you’ve just joined the Dragon Group, and it’ll take some time for you to fit in here. Don’t mind those people. Once you prove your strength, they will show you respect," Mu Zhige explained, a mere formality, as he said this to cover up his own role in spreading the rumors about Ye Xiaozhang’s arrogance at the leader’s behest, especially once he saw those Dragon Group members and felt a twinge of guilt as he hurriedly dragged Ye Qiu away, fearing someone would reveal the words had come from him.
"Brother Ye, you rest here for a while. I’m going to prepare some life necessities for you, so when you come back here in the future, you need not look further," Mu Zhige said, leaving the room first.
Ye Qiu surveyed the special room, having to admit that a metal-constructed room was rather interesting—as his sense of perception met with the obstruction of the metal, it seemed like it hit a barrier, cutting off further investigation.
Ye Qiu touched the metal panel of the room, revealing a look of considerable interest.
It was only a few minutes before Mu Zhige returned, carrying a blanket and some toiletries, placing them on the bed.
"Alright, Brother Ye, shall I show you around?" Mu Zhige asked.
Ye Qiu was also eager to learn more about this place, the most powerful secret force in China, the Dragon Group. What exactly made this place special? He was naturally very curious.
Leading the way, Mu Zhige introduced the surrounding facilities, especially when Ye Qiu saw a swimming pool that was hundreds of meters long, he was somewhat stunned. An underground swimming pool? Ye Qiu hadn’t expected to see a swimming pool here and was genuinely surprised.
"You see that over there? That’s where we usually train."
"Hmm, this room is the music room. It’s used for relaxation after training."
"Behind this door is a library, with all sorts of books, both in print and digital. You could say it rivals the national library; there’s nothing you can’t find."
It wasn’t until the two of them arrived at the end of the corridor and stopped in front of the last iron door that Mu Zhige’s expression changed slightly, and Ye Qiu asked in surprise, "What is this place?"
Mu Zhige smiled and explained, "This is our members’ favorite place to enter in the Dragon Group, and it is also the most treasured part of the entire secret base."
"Its name is the Gravity Training Room. It’s controlled by high-tech to produce various forces, so as to provide breakthrough training for the human body."
"Some also call it the Devil’s Training Room because everyone who enters it undergoes a challenge of human physical limits."
"It’s something people love and hate."
Listening to Mu Zhige’s high praise for the Gravity Training Room, Ye Qiu’s interest deepened. The Gravity Training Room—just the name sounded intriguing. Could it be using the pressure of gravity to unleash oneself, to dig out potential?
Ye Qiu speculated quietly.
As Ye Qiu and Mu Zhige stood in front of the Gravity Training Room, suddenly the door opened automatically.
With it, a figure slowly entered their field of view.
"Si Ma’ao!" Mu Zhige was momentarily taken aback.
The latter walked out of the Gravity Training Room, and upon seeing the two of them, particularly when he noticed Ye Qiu next to Mu Zhige, he couldn’t help but ask, "Who is he?"
"Oh?" Mu Zhige took a good while to recover his composure, somewhat wary of Si Ma’ao, he explained, "He is the new member who has just joined our Dragon Group, Ye Qiu."
"Ye Qiu?" Si Ma’ao at first was shocked, then his body burst forth with an imposing aura.
"You’re saying he’s Ye Qiu? That Ye Xiaozhang?" Si Ma’ao’s gaze suddenly fixed on Ye Qiu.
Mu Zhige hadn’t expected Si Ma’ao’s sudden change, from being genial to almost bursting with aggression.
"Yes, he’s Ye Qiu," Mu Zhige still nodded.
Ye Qiu’s gaze collided with Si Ma’ao’s intense expression. With his upper body bare, covered in sweat, his muscles were rugged and prominent, clearly displaying his strength.
Ye Qiu was both surprised by the man’s aura and muttering to himself how he had suddenly become the Ye Xiaozhang in the other’s mouth.
It seemed Ye Qiu was visiting the Dragon Group’s secret base for the first time today; how could he have inexplicably seemed to make so many enemies?
